CNC lathe threading is a critical process in machining, allowing for the creation of helical ridges on the external or internal surfaces of a workpiece. These threads are essential for various applications, from industrial machinery to everyday items. Mastering this technique requires a solid grasp of both the machine's capabilities and the threading process.

The CNC programming language (G-code) will vary based on the machine, but most require basic commands to initiate threading. Familiarize yourself with commands like G76 for threading cycles, where you can specify thread pitch and depth.
Always run a simulation of your tool path before executing a new program. This step can help identify any potential collisions or issues in advance.
